What is the difference Among OM1, OM2, OM3, OM4 and OM5

Multimode fibers are identified by the OM (“optical mode”) designation as outlined in the ISO/IEC 11801 standard. OM1, for fiber with 200/500MHz*km overfilled launch (OFL) bandwidth at 850/1300nm (typically 62.5/125um fiber) OM2, Type A1a.1 , for fiber with 500/500MHz*km OFL bandwidth at 850/1300nm (typically 50/125um fiber) OM3, Type A1a.2, for laser-optimized 50um fiber having 2GHz*km […]

OM4 fiber optic cabling

What is OM4 ? Based on The New TIA/EIA Standard, OM4 is a laser-optimized, high bandwidth 50µm multimode fiber. In August of 2009, TIA/EIA approved and released 492AAAD, which defines the performance criteria for this grade of optical fiber. While they developed the original “OM” designations, IEC has not yet released an approved equivalent standard […]

50um or 62.5um fiber for Data Center

In terms of physical properties, the difference between these two fiber types is the diameter of the core—the light-carrying region of the fiber. In 62.5/125 fiber, the core has a diameter of 62.5 microns and the cladding diameter is 125 microns. For 50/125, the core has a diameter of 50 microns with the same cladding […]
